The Roundup

Glencoe 3 , Watertown 0
Wed ., June 1
It was scoreless through six innings as Watertown ’ s Justin Kohls and Glencoe ’ s Cole Petersen kept mowing down opposing hitters .
The Brewers finally tallied one in the seventh and two more insurance runs in the eighth for the win , while Petersen kept the shutout intact . Both pitchers went the distance and each gave up only four hits .
Glencoe ’ s hits were by Mason Goettl ( who had two RBIs ), Tanner Grack , Jaime Paumen , and Brandon Ebert .
For Watertown , Patrick Tschida and Bryce Walt had two apiece , one of Tschida ’ s being a double .
Green Isle 19 , Mayer 3
Wed ., June 1 The Irish struck for six runs in each of the first two innings on the way to 19-3 decision .
Josh Anthony was a perfect 3-for-3 plus two walks while Ben Alexander , Aaron Bigaouette , Josh Kraby , Bjorn Hansen , and Ryan Evanson all had two hits apiece for Green Isle . Alexander and Evanon each knocked in four runs . Zach Herad , Anthony , and Alexander each scored three times .
David Cushing went the first four innings on the mound for the win , relieved by Josh Schmidt and Alex Twenge .
Mayer managed three hits – one each by Dylan Malberg , Jordan Berrios , and Adam Parker .
Young America 4 , Carver 2
Wed ., June 1
Isaac Hormann homered in the first inning to set the stage as the Cardinals went on to top Carver 4-2 .
Young America added another run in the first , plus single runs in the second ( a Logan Harms homer ) and third . Meanwhile , Hormann pitched six strong innings and Tanner Kohls picked up the save in the final three .
Hormann and Roch Whittaker each were 2-for-4 at the plate for YA .
David Dolan had the only multi-hit game for Carver , also going 2-for-4 with a double . He and Dustin Brockoff had the RBIs for the Black Sox .
Andrew Weber went the distance for Carver , allowing only two earned runs on eight hits with five strikeouts .

Greeen Isle 2 , Carver 0
Sat ., June 4
Alex Twenge ’ s 16 strikeouts led the Irish to a 2-0 win over the Black Sox in a pitchers ’ duel . Twenge allowed just two hits to go with his 16 strikeouts in a complete game shutout .
Andrew Weber and Anthony Gross had the lone two hits for the Black Sox in the loss . Jack Norton took the loss on the mound . He went nine innings , allowing two unearned runs while striking out seven .
For the Irish , Bjorn Hansen went 1-for-3 with a run scored .
